Colloidal Gel — Arrested Phase Separation

Short-range attraction + repulsion arrests spinodal decomposition into fractal network

Colloidal gels form when short-range attractions cause spinodal decomposition but glass transition arrests the dense phase before it can fully coarsen. The result is a space-spanning fractal network (d_f ≈ 2.0–2.5) that supports stress. ε/kT > 3 and low φ are typical gel conditions.
